How to Check a Telkom Number

Knowing how to check a Telkom number is useful if you have forgotten your cellphone number, are using a new SIM card, or need to share your number with someone. Telkom provides several ways to identify your number, including using your phone’s settings, checking your SIM information, or contacting customer support. The exact method may vary depending on your device and Telkom service.

  1. Use a USSD Service

One of the easiest ways to check your Telkom number is by using a Telkom USSD service.

Open your phone’s dialling application and enter the appropriate Telkom number-checking USSD code. Follow the instructions displayed on your screen.

  1. Check Your Phone Settings

You may also find your mobile number in your phone’s settings.

On many Android phones, open Settings, go to About Phone or SIM Status, and look for the phone number associated with the SIM card.

On an iPhone, open Settings, select Phone, and check My Number.

  1. Call or Send a Message to Another Phone

If you have airtime or access to your mobile service, call another phone nearby.

Your Telkom number should appear on the other person’s screen if caller ID is enabled. You can also send a message and ask the recipient to tell you the number displayed.

  1. Check Your SIM or Account Information

If you registered your Telkom SIM card or received documentation when purchasing it, your number may be included in the information provided.

You can also check your Telkom account or customer information if your number is linked to an online profile.

  1. Contact Telkom Customer Support

If you cannot find your number using the available methods, contact Telkom customer support.

Be prepared to verify your identity and provide the information requested by the consultant.
